Silvio Berlusconi promised €5 million to Ruby the Heart Stealer for her silence about their relationship

Silvio Berlusconi was “crazy” about the teenage exotic dancer who allegedly had sex with the former prime minister and promised to pay her 5 million euros (£4 million) to buy her silence, according to leaked telephone intercepts.

Karima El Mahroug, better known by her stage name Ruby the Heart Stealer, is heard telling a friend in October 2010 that she and her lawyer had requested 5 million euros and that Mr Berlusconi had accepted their demand…

The audio conversation published by Italian newspaper, La Repubblica, on its website, is one of several recorded by police for Milan prosecutors between October 26 – 28 2010, after news broke that the then 17-year-old was among the guests at the ex-premier’s ‘bunga bunga’ parties at his luxury mansion outside Milan…

The billionaire politician, who resigned in November, is on trial in Milan on charges of paying for sex with Miss El Mahroug whom prosecutors allege was working as a prostitute.

He is also accused of abuse of office by pressuring police in Milan to release her from custody after she was arrested on suspicion of stealing cash and jewellery from a flat mate.

In another conversation recorded on October 28 2010, Miss El Mahroug is heard telling a friend named only as Antonella how excited she is…

“Silvio called me yesterday saying ‘Ruby how much money do you want?,” Miss El Mahroug says in the conversation.

“I will pay you whatever you want, I will dress you in gold but it ‘s important you hide everything. Do not say anything to anyone…”

Witnesses have described starlets and showgirls performing stripteases, which were held at the former prime minister’s villa at Arcore.

The parties were nothing more than “elegant dinners”, he said, repeating a defence that he has used ever since the scandal broke two years ago.

The trial continues.

Our favorite corrupt politician, Silvio Berlusconi paid €127,000 to witnesses in trial


Silvio and his best American bubba

Italy’s former prime minister Silvio Berlusconi has handed out cash gifts worth more than €100,000 to young women due to testify in his trial on charges of paying an underage prostitute.

Berlusconi has reportedly paid €127,000 to three witnesses since his trial began last April before allegedly putting pressure on Milan police to hush up the case. The trial centres on Moroccan runaway Karima el-Mahroug, known as Ruby the Heart Stealer, who attended so-called “bunga bunga” parties at Berlusconi’s mansion outside Milan in 2010.

Prosecutors allege the parties were organised by Nicole Minetti, a former dental hygienist turned TV showgirl who was nominated a councillor for the Lombardy region by Berlusconi’s party. Minetti, who is also standing trial separately for procuring prostitutes for the former prime minister, was paid €55,000 by him in two instalments in October and November, prosecutors say, according to Italian newspaper Corriere della Sera.

Two regular guests at those parties, sisters Eleonora and Imma de Vivo – models who appeared on an Italian celebrity reality show – received €72,000, paid by Berlusconi via their father, in July and October.

One party guest, dancer Maria Makdoum, has told prosecutors she saw the de Vivo twins dancing around Berlusconi in their knickers and bra at one of his after-dinner bunga bunga sessions. Berlusconi “was touching their intimate parts and they were touching him,” she said.

Berlusconi’s lawyer, Niccolò Ghedini, admitted payments had been made to Minetti and the de Vivos, but denied they were intended to sway their testimony.

The linking of the payments with the fact they are witnesses in the so-called Ruby trial is absolutely spurious and without foundation,” Ghedini said.

Berlusconi gave €7,000 to 17-year-old belly dancer

The latest sex scandal threatening Silvio Berlusconi has deepened after a 17-year-old Moroccan belly dancer linked to the Italian prime minister said he had given her €7,000 and jewellery when she sat next to him at a Valentine’s Day dinner held this year for 10 women at his mansion near Milan.

The girl, named in the Italian media as Karima Keyek but known more widely by her stage name Ruby Rubacuori, or Stealer of Hearts, denies sleeping with Berlusconi.

“It is the first time in my life that a man has not tried to take me to bed. He behaved like a father, I swear,” she told La Repubblica from Genoa, where she is hiding out in an apartment allegedly lent to her by a former porn star.

But she has painted a vivid portrait of private parties held by the 74-year-old prime minister, known by the Italian media as lavish affairs that often transformed into “bunga-bunga” sessions involving after-dinner sex between male and female guests.

In La Repubblica yesterday, Keyek said her host had told her not to come to see him any more after discovering she was not, as she had claimed, 24. “Berlusconi said he had had enough problems in the past with another underage girl,” she said…

“He gave me an envelope with €7,000 in it and I told him I dreamed of gaining Italian citizenship and becoming a policewoman.” She told La Repubblica: “It was like going to the church charity where they give you a bag of shopping…”

Yesterday the respected Corriere della Sera newspaper reported that Berlusconi had personally informed a senior police official that Keyek was related to Egypt’s President Hosni Mubarak. Berlusconi says he merely told police he was dispatching a colleague to take temporary custody of Keyek should she be released – from charges of theft.
